How to decode a 1990 Oldsmobile Cutlass Cruiser VIN

Characters 1-3 of a 1990 Oldsmobile Cutlass Cruiser VIN

A World Manufacturer Identifier (WMI) is a unique code assigned to every vehicle manufacturer globally. The first three characters of a VIN (Vehicle Identification Number), the WMI is crucial in identifying the vehicle’s country of origin, manufacturer, and vehicle type. For example, an Oldsmobile Cutlass Cruiser from the 1990 model year would have a WMI indicating it was manufactured by General Motors LLC in Warren, Michigan, United States. This code not only signifies that the vehicle is a passenger car but also locates its production origin within a specific facility. Understanding the WMI is essential for tracing a vehicle’s manufacturing details and authenticity.

Characters 4-8 are the Vehicle Descriptor Section (VDS) of a 1990 Oldsmobile Cutlass Cruiser VIN

These characters correspond to components like:

  • Engine type
  • Transmission
  • Model or trim
  • Body style
  • Gross vehicle weight range

Auto manufacturers have some discretion to decide how they want to code this section, but its contents and decoded results are generally consistent.

Character 9 is the “check digit” in a 1990 Oldsmobile Cutlass Cruiser VIN.

Based on a formula developed by the US Department of Transportation, it helps reduce fraud by ensuring the validity of the VIN.

VIN Characters 12 - 17 of a 1990 Oldsmobile Cutlass Cruiser

The final 6 characters in a 1990 Oldsmobile Cutlass Cruiser’s 17-digit VIN are its serial number, which will be unique to every vehicle.

How to find a 1990 Oldsmobile Cutlass Cruiser’s VIN?

Locating the VIN number on your 1990 Oldsmobile Cutlass Cruiser is key for identification. Here’s how to find it:

  1. Look at the dashboard on the driver’s side of the 1990 Oldsmobile Cutlass Cruiser. The VIN should be visible through the windshield on a metal plate.
  2. Examine the door jamb on the driver’s side of your Oldsmobile Cutlass Cruiser. The VIN can often be found on a label or sticker where the door latches.
  3. Check the engine block of the Cutlass Cruiser where the VIN may also be stamped. This might require you to physically look at the engine itself for any embossed numbers.
  4. Inspect the rear wheel well on the driver’s side. Sometimes, the VIN is placed slightly above the tire.
  5. Look at the frame of the car underneath the vehicle. You may need to crawl under your Cutlass Cruiser and search for the VIN on the chassis. It may be located near the front of the frame.
  6. Review your Oldsmobile Cutlass Cruiser’s insurance and registration documents, as they will list the VIN. This is not a physical location on the car, but it is a reliable source for the number if you need it for documentation purposes.
